Paver Flooring Installation in Denver County, CO
Paver flooring installation involves placing durable, decorative paving materials to create functional and attractive surfaces for outdoor spaces. This service covers a variety of projects, including patios, walkways, driveways, pool surrounds, and garden paths. Property owners typically want to understand the different types of pavers available, such as concrete, brick, or stone, as well as the benefits of each. Additionally, they often seek information about the installation process, surface preparation, and how to ensure long-lasting results for their outdoor areas.
Before requesting paver flooring installation, homeowners usually consider factors like the intended use of the space, aesthetic preferences, and budget. It’s also helpful to know about the maintenance requirements of different paver materials and any necessary site preparation, such as leveling or base work. Understanding these aspects can assist property owners in making informed decisions to achieve a durable, visually appealing outdoor surface that meets their needs.

Paver Flooring Installation Questions
What types of paver flooring are available for installation? Common options include concrete, brick, and natural stone pavers, each offering different styles and durability for outdoor spaces.
Can paver flooring be used for driveways and walkways? Yes, paver flooring is suitable for driveways, walkways, patios, and other outdoor surfaces due to its strength and aesthetic appeal.
What should property owners consider before installing paver flooring? It’s important to evaluate the existing terrain, drainage needs, and the desired visual style to ensure proper installation and longevity.
